CVE-2020-1455 is a vulnerability in Microsoft Sql Server Management Studio
Published on August 17, 2020
Microsoft SQL Server Management Studio Denial of Service Vulnerability
A denial of service vulnerability exists when Microsoft SQL Server Management Studio (SSMS) improperly handles files. An attacker could exploit the vulnerability to trigger a denial of service.
To exploit the vulnerability, an attacker would first require execution on the victim system.
The security update addresses the vulnerability by ensuring Microsoft SQL Server Management Studio properly handles files.
